Composition:
DROTAVERINE-80MG + PARACETAMOL-500MG
Uses:
Abdominal pain and cramps.
Medicinal Benefits:
Drolin-P Tablet consists of Drotaverine (antispasmodic) and Paracetamol (pain killer). It relieves abdominal pain, and muscle spasms in the gastrointestinal tract, urinary tract and gall bladder. Drotaverine works by reducing contractions (spasms) associated with smooth muscles of the abdomen. Paracetamol is an analgesic (pain reliever) and an antipyretic (fever reducer). It inhibits cyclo-oxygenase (COX) enzymes that further prevents the formation of chemical messengers called 'prostaglandins' (PGs). These prostaglandins are produced at injury sites and cause pain and swelling. By blocking COX enzyme's effect, lesser PGs are produced, which reduces mild to moderate pain and inflammation at the injured or damaged site. Together, Drolin-P Tablet helps in relieving abdominal pain and cramps.
Drolin-P Tablet is a combination of two drugs: Drotaverine and Paracetamol. Drotaverine works by relieving contractions associated with smooth muscles of the abdomen. Paracetamol works by blocking the action of certain chemical messengers that cause pain.
Drolin-P Tablet may cause dizziness. So, drive only if you are alert and avoid driving or operating machinery if you feel dizzy.
Drolin-P Tablet is usually used for a short period and can be discontinued if there is no pain. However, it should be continued if advised by the doctor.
Drolin-P Tablet is to be carefully administered in patients with alcohol dependency or a history of kidney or liver damage. Please consult your doctor before starting Drolin-P Tablet if you have a medical history.
